[SB Plugin] ダウンロードカウンタの使い方 for v0.11

▶ in SereneBach > Plugin posted 2009.11.25 Wednesday / 23:54

機能概要

本プラグインは、KENT氏作のLimeCounterをSereneBachのプラグインとして移植したものです。
(SereneBachには、アクセス解析がプラグインとして標準添付されていますのでページカウンタとしての機能は外してあります。)
LimeCounterの管理画面とSereneBachの管理画面を統合することによりSereneBachの管理画面で集計一覧及びダウンロードの新規追加・編集・削除が出来るようになっています。
更に、下記の独自ブロックと独自タグをテンプレートに挿入する事により集計一覧を外部にも公開する事が出来ます。


独自ブロック

limecounter


独自タグ

limecounter_list集計一覧を表示する。
limecounter_cssコンテンツ用のCSSをリンクタグごと表示する。(<head>タグ内へ挿入。)


動作確認 version

Serene Bach 2.21R (UTF-8版)


ファイル構成

本プラグインアーカイブには以下のファイルが同梱されています。
readme.txt説明書
lime.cgiダウンロードカウンタを処理するcgiスクリプト
plugin/limecounter.pmプラグインファイル
plugin/resource/ja/limecounter.txt管理画面表示用日本語リソースファイル
plugin/resource/ja/limecounter.html管理画面用ファイル
data/lime/lime.logダウンロード情報を保存するインデックスファイル


インストール

添付ファイルをそれぞれ以下の場所に設置して下さい。
plugin/ ディレクトリ内 (パーミッション例 : 644)limecounter.pm
plugin/resource/ja/ ディレクトリ内 (パーミッション例: 644)limecounter.html
limecounter.txt
data/lime/ ディレクトリ内 (パーミッション例: 666)lime.log
limeディレクトリとlime.logファイルは、設定項目から変更可能。
data/lime/ ディレクトリ内 (パーミッション例: 644)index.html
Serene Bach 設置ディレクトリ (パーミッション例 : 755)lime.cgi
lime.cgi は sb.cgi/admin.cgi と同じディレクトリに同じパーミッションで置いて下さい。


使用方法

本プラグインの機能を使用するには、本プラグインをインストールした上で管理画面の「環境設定」→「プラグイン」にて有効化します。
その後、独自ブロックと独自タグを HTML テンプレートに記述して下さい。
独自ブロック・独自タグの指定例は以下の通りです。

<head>

<!-- BEGIN limecounter -->

{limecounter_css}

<!-- END limecounter -->

</head>

<body>

<!-- BEGIN limecounter -->

{limecounter_list}

<!-- END limecounter -->

</body>


スクリーンショット

lime_list.jpg lime_edit.jpg lime_new.jpg lime_setting.jpg


著作権・利用条件等

当プラグインの著作権は Assy にあります。
当プラグインを利用した事によるいかなる損害も作者(Assy)は一切の責任を負いません。
プラグインの再配布及び改変は自由です。

尚、下記の利用規定も読んでください。
オリジナルCGIスクリプト利用規定


今後の予定

  • テンプレートでの表示に使用するCSSを管理画面で変更できるようにする。
  • ダウンロードする為のリンクタグの簡易挿入支援を実装する。
  • ダウンロードする為の画像ファイルも設定できるようにする。

[SB Plugin] ダウンロードカウンタ v0.11 リリース

▶ in SereneBach > Plugin posted 2009.11.25 Wednesday / 23:50

※2009年12月7日 v0.12リリースしております。

KENT氏作のLime CounterをSereneBachのプラグインとして改造して公開しております。

尚、当プラグインを利用する方は必ずKENT-WEBのCGIスクリプト利用規定をご一読ください。

LimeCounterプラグインの使用方法は、ダウンロードファイル内のreadme.txtかこちらをお読みください。

v0.11では、v0.10 から以下のバグが修正されています。
  • アイテムを削除できないバグを修正しました。

また、以下の仕様変更があります。
  • lime.cgiの動作チェックを管理画面に追加しました。

Download

[SB Plugin] ダウンロードカウンタ v0.10 リリース

▶ in SereneBach > Plugin posted 2009.11.20 Friday / 23:42

※2009年11月25日 v0.11リリースしております。

KENT氏作のLime CounterをSereneBachのプラグインとして改造して公開しております。

バージョン0.10から別途LimeCounterをインストールしなくてもプラグインのみで使用出来るようになりました。

尚、当プラグインを利用する方は必ずKENT-WEBのCGIスクリプト利用規定をご一読ください。

【v0.00からの更新内容】

■v0.10 (2009年11月20日 23:40)
別途オリジナルのLimeCounterをインストールしなくても動作するように変更しました。

Download
PAGE TOP